Specialties

ADHD

ADHD impacts all areas of life - work, home, family, friendships…everything. Therapy for ADHD gives you a space to develop systems to make life more manageable, understand the way your brain works, and unravel the shame and self-criticism you’ve been feeling your whole life.

Highly Sensitive People (HSP)

Therapy for HSPs offers a nurturing space where sensitivity is honored, not dismissed. It empowers individuals to embrace their unique gifts, navigate overwhelm with greater ease, and build resilience, leading to a deeper sense of self-acceptance and fulfillment.

Trauma & PTSD

Trauma therapy is about so much more than healing from the past. It's about reclaiming your power and finding resilience you never knew you had. It's a journey of healing where every step forward brings you closer to a life filled with strength, hope, and possibility.

2. Intake Appointment & Goal Setting
Your first appointment will be focused on sharing about your history (to the extent that you feel comfortable) and each of us getting to know each other. We’ll talk about what’s causing you the most stress and set specific goals for our work together. If you plan to seek reimbursement from your insurance company for out-of-network benefits, we’ll discuss a diagnosis (a diagnosis is required with insurance). If you’re not using out-of-network benefits, a diagnosis is not required.

3. Regular Therapy Sessions
Once we’ve determined your goals together, we’ll start our regular therapy sessions. I recommend weekly sessions when we begin our work. This helps us to build trust and gain traction so you can start to feel relief as soon as possible. Sometimes it’s appropriate to meet every other week. The frequency of sessions all depends on what your goals are - we can talk more about it in your consultation call!
